[...] ... hier die fehlende Diode: * ******************************************* * *BZX84-C15 * *NXP Semiconductors * *Voltage regulator diode * * * * * *VFmax = 0,9V @ IF = 10mA *IRmax = 0,05渙 @ VR = 10,5V * *VZmax = 15,6V @ IZ = 5mA * * * *Ptot = 250mW * * * *Package pinning does not match Spice model pinning. *Package: SOT23 (TO236AB) * *Package Pin 1: Anode *Package Pin 2: not connected *Package Pin 3: Cathode * * *Extraction date (week/year): 01/2016 *Simulator: SPICE2 * ******************************************* *# .SUBCKT BZX84-C15 1 2 R1 1 2 1E+012 D1 1 2 + DIODE1 D2 1 2 + DIODE2 * *The resistor R1 and the diode D2 *do not reflect *physical devices but improve *only modeling in the reverse *mode of operation. * .MODEL DIODE1 D + IS = 4E-016 + N = 1 + BV = 15 + IBV = 1E-008 + RS = 0.45 + CJO = 3.232E-011 + VJ = 0.595 + M = 0.325 + FC = 0.5 + TT = 0 + EG = 1.1 + XTI = 3 .MODEL DIODE2 D + IS = 1E-013 + N = 12 + RS = 1E+005 .ENDS *
